I think that statement is too strong, the article suggests that the authors have proposed a speculative new principle for how QM would work in a context where time travel was allowed (which doesn't follow directly from the basic laws of QM, since they are formulated in locally flat spacetime where time travel doesn't happen), so that, if the laws of physics respected this principle, paradoxes would be avoided:
Lorenzo Maccone, of the Massachusetts Institute of Technology and the University of Pavia, Italy, and his colleagues propose a more stringent condition that avoids these difficulties. They require that any measurement of the particle going into the future should yield the same result as measuring it when it returns from the past. So any state that would alter the past when it came around again is disallowed, and no grandfather-type paradoxes can arise.
Anyway, it sounds like this is just a new quantum variant of the Novikov self-consistency principle which is how physicists usually propose that paradoxes would be avoided in spacetimes with closed timelike curves (the other way of avoiding paradoxes that GrayGhost mentions, parallel timelines, is not commonly proposed as a resolution although David Deutsch did make a suggestion along these lines)

This is not what anyone means by "go back in time". The general relativity version of time travel is that ordinary motion in some direction in space will somehow take you to an event earlier in the history of e.g. the city you live in. For this to be possible, spacetime must actually contain a curve that describes a way that you can move to accomplish this.

I kinda like the way an excerpt from this http://www.webfilesuci.org/wormholeFAQ.html" summarizes the way time travel paradoxes are dealt with:

Isn’t time travel by wormhole or any other means impossible due to the paradoxes that it implies?
Not necessarily. Dealing with time travel paradoxes by conjecturing the impossibility of time travel is only one of three ways of resolving the issue. The other ways are:
1) Impose self consistency on classical physics: A time traveler cannot change the past because he was always part of it. When he attempts to change the past, his efforts will be thwarted by an apparent conspiracy of events. 2) Impose self consistency on quantum physics: A time traveler cannot change the past because all possible pasts have already occurred in parallel universes. When he attempts to change the past, his efforts will not seem to him to be thwarted. This is because he will have entered the past of a preexisting parallel universe in which he has already made the changes that he seeks to effect.

1. What is the paradox of time travel?

The paradox of time travel is a theoretical concept that suggests that if time travel were possible, it could create contradictions or logical impossibilities. This is because if someone were to travel back in time and change an event, it could alter the future in a way that would make the time travel itself impossible.

2. Is the paradox of time travel a real scientific theory?

No, the paradox of time travel is not a scientifically proven theory. It is a concept that has been explored in science fiction and philosophical discussions, but there is currently no scientific evidence to support the idea of time travel.

3. What are some examples of paradoxes in time travel?

One example is the grandfather paradox, which suggests that if someone were to travel back in time and kill their own grandfather before their parent was born, it would create a contradiction because the time traveler would not exist in the present to go back in time. Another example is the bootstrap paradox, where an object or information is sent back in time without a clear origin, creating a loop in time.

4. Can the paradox of time travel be resolved?

There is currently no consensus on how to resolve the paradox of time travel. Some theories suggest that time travel could create alternate timelines or parallel universes, while others propose that there may be some sort of self-correcting mechanism in the universe to prevent paradoxes from occurring.

5. How does the paradox of time travel relate to Einstein's theory of relativity?

Einstein's theory of relativity suggests that time is a relative concept and can be affected by gravity and motion. This theory has been used to explore the concept of time travel, but it also presents challenges in trying to understand the paradox of time travel. Some scientists argue that the paradox could be resolved by considering the effects of relativity on time travel.
